The past four decades have witnessed a rapid and tremendous development in information and communication technologies (ICT), which has led to development in various theoretical and practical fields. In addition, technological diffusion has become a prominent feature in developed countries, which made most developing countries seek to own it because it is the backbone and the main pillar of its development and prosperity. Although Iraq is a country with diverse and enormous resources and a dominant geographical position that makes it at the forefront of the regional and global economy, it still suffers from crises and stagnation due to regional and global conflicts as a battlefield, as well as successive mismanagement and lack of technological awareness in simulating the rapid development of ICT with modern and high technology. In this paper, we will come to learn in brief about the Information and Communication Technology (ICT) and its role in community development will be briefly identified. We also look at the general technological diffusion index by analysing its main and sub-indicators to the Arab countries group, and then we focus on the main obstacles and challenges facing it in Iraq. Last but not least, we will try to lay the scientific foundations according to modern ICT indicators to overcome and defuse those challenges, and finally we have made suggestions and recommendations that contribute to the achievement of the goal that we aspire for throughout this research.
